Pollen grain morphology of the arboreal Apocynaceae in the state of Santa Catarina, Brazil

The pollen morphology of seven species belonging to three genera of the Apocynaceae family and occurring in the state of Santa Catarina, Brazil, was considered in the present paper. The pollen grains of three species of Aspidosperma [A. australe Muell. Arg., A. pyricollum Muell. Arg. e A. ramiflorum Muell. Arg.] correspond to a same pollen type, and present no specific morphological features. Similar observation was made of the three species of Peschiera (Peschiera cf. australis (Muell. Arg.) Miers, Peschiera catharinensis (DC) Miers e Peschiera aff. histrix (Stend.) DC. Rauvolfia sellowii Muell. Arg. presents a characteristic pollen morphology of oblate and brevicolpate pollen grains. The occurrence of a vestibulum in the apertural area of the pollen grains is a attribute of all species examined.
